There actually be consent, express or implied; From someone with the authority to give the consent in question; The consent be voluntary and not the product of police oppression, coercion or other external conduct which negated the freedom to choose whether or not to allow the police to pursue the course of conduct requested; The giver of the consent be aware of the nature of the police conduct to which he or she was being asked to consent; The giver of the consent be aware of his or her right to refuse to permit the police to engage in the conduct requested; and. The phone calls and creditor harassment had reached the point where []. to protect the life or safety of someone inside if they have a reasonable belief that a life-threatening emergency exists, to protect the life or safety of people in the home if someone heard a gunshot inside, to prevent something that may be about to happen, if they have a reasonable belief that their entry is necessary to stop it or to protect their safety or the safety of the public, to help someone who has reported a domestic assault to remove their belongings safely, to protect people from injury if the police have reason to suspect that there is a drug laboratory in the house, to help animals in immediate distress because of injury, illness, abuse, or neglect, the child is neglected or abused and is in need of protection, the child is a runaway under the age of 16, who was in the care of a childrens aid society, and whose health or safety might be at risk during the time needed to get a warrant, the child is under 12 years old and has done something that would be an offence if someone 12 or older had done it.
